Suggest Treatment For Persistent Dizziness And Weakness Of The Legs

My 20 year old daughter is experiencing fainting spells. She feels them coming on. She has about five minutes before these spells hit her. Then she feels like everything is falling in, she s white as a sheet, and she is perspiring a lot. She looses strength in her legs and falls or needs to sit down immediately.

In my opinion, we should rule out brain any spinal cord related diseases first because fainting attack, loss of balance, lose of strength in lower limbs etc are commonly seen with brain and spinal cord diseases.
So consult neurologist and get done clinical examination, MRI brain and spine.
If all these are normal then no need to worry much.
Sometimes, stress and anxiety can also cause similar symptoms.
So avoid stress and tension, be relax and calm.
Don't worry, you will be alright. But first rule out brain and spine pathology.
